Understanding the Basics of Asphalt Pumps
Before we discuss maintenance costs, let’s briefly understand what an asphalt pump is and how it works. Asphalt pumps are designed to transfer hot asphalt from storage tanks to paving equipment or other applications. They are typically used in road construction, roofing, and other industries where asphalt is a key material.
There are different types of asphalt pumps, including gear pumps, rotor pumps, and screw pumps, each with its own advantages and characteristics. Gear pumps are known for their simplicity and reliability, while rotor pumps offer high efficiency and low pulsation. Screw pumps, on the other hand, are suitable for handling high-viscosity fluids and can provide a continuous flow.
Factors Affecting the Maintenance Cost of an Asphalt Pump
The maintenance cost of an asphalt pump can vary depending on several factors. Here are some of the key factors that you need to consider:
1. Type of Pump
As mentioned earlier, different types of asphalt pumps have different maintenance requirements. Gear pumps, for example, are relatively simple in design and have fewer moving parts, which generally translates to lower maintenance costs. Rotor pumps and screw pumps, on the other hand, may require more frequent maintenance due to their complex mechanics.
2. Operating Conditions
The operating conditions of an asphalt pump can have a significant impact on its maintenance cost. Pumps that operate in harsh environments, such as high temperatures, high pressures, or abrasive materials, are more likely to experience wear and tear and require more frequent maintenance. Additionally, pumps that are used continuously or at high speeds may also have a higher maintenance cost compared to those used intermittently or at lower speeds.
3. Quality of the Pump
The quality of the asphalt pump itself is another important factor to consider. Higher-quality pumps are often made from more durable materials and are designed to withstand the rigors of continuous operation. While they may have a higher upfront cost, they can also result in lower maintenance costs over the long term.
4. Maintenance Schedule
Following a regular maintenance schedule is essential for keeping an asphalt pump in good working condition and minimizing the risk of breakdowns. A well-planned maintenance schedule should include tasks such as lubrication, inspection, and replacement of worn parts. Neglecting regular maintenance can lead to premature wear and tear and increase the likelihood of costly repairs.
5. Cost of Replacement Parts
The cost of replacement parts is another significant factor in the maintenance cost of an asphalt pump. Some parts, such as seals, gaskets, and bearings, may need to be replaced periodically to ensure the proper functioning of the pump. The cost of these parts can vary depending on the brand, quality, and availability.
Breakdown of Maintenance Costs
Now that we’ve discussed the factors that affect the maintenance cost of an asphalt pump, let’s take a closer look at the different types of maintenance costs that you can expect:
1. Routine Maintenance
Routine maintenance tasks include lubrication, inspection, and cleaning of the pump. These tasks are typically performed on a regular basis, such as daily, weekly, or monthly, depending on the operating conditions of the pump. The cost of routine maintenance is relatively low and can be estimated based on the cost of lubricants, cleaning materials, and labor.
2. Preventive Maintenance
Preventive maintenance involves the replacement of worn parts before they fail. This can help to prevent breakdowns and extend the lifespan of the pump. The cost of preventive maintenance can vary depending on the type of parts that need to be replaced and the frequency of replacement.
3. Corrective Maintenance
Corrective maintenance is performed when the pump breaks down or malfunctions. This can include repairs or replacement of damaged parts. The cost of corrective maintenance can be significant, especially if the breakdown is severe or if the replacement parts are expensive.
4. Emergency Maintenance
Emergency maintenance is required when the pump fails unexpectedly and causes a disruption to operations. This can be a costly and time-consuming process, as it may require immediate repairs or replacement of the pump. The cost of emergency maintenance can include the cost of labor, replacement parts, and any downtime associated with the breakdown.
Tips for Reducing Maintenance Costs
While the maintenance cost of an asphalt pump is inevitable, there are several steps that you can take to reduce these costs:
1. Choose the Right Pump
Selecting the right type and size of asphalt pump for your application is crucial. A pump that is too small may not be able to handle the required flow rate, while a pump that is too large may be inefficient and costly to operate. By choosing the right pump, you can minimize the risk of breakdowns and reduce the need for frequent maintenance.
2. Follow the Manufacturer’s Recommendations
The manufacturer’s recommendations for maintenance and operation are based on extensive testing and research. By following these recommendations, you can ensure that your asphalt pump is operating at its optimal level and minimize the risk of premature wear and tear.
3. Train Your Staff
Proper training of your staff is essential for the safe and efficient operation of an asphalt pump. Make sure that your operators are familiar with the pump’s operation, maintenance requirements, and safety procedures. This can help to prevent breakdowns and reduce the likelihood of costly repairs.
4. Use High-Quality Lubricants and Parts
Using high-quality lubricants and replacement parts can help to extend the lifespan of your asphalt pump and reduce the need for frequent maintenance. While these products may be more expensive upfront, they can save you money in the long run by reducing the risk of breakdowns and costly repairs.
5. Monitor the Pump’s Performance
Regularly monitoring the performance of your asphalt pump can help you to detect any potential problems early on and take corrective action before they become major issues. This can include monitoring the pump’s flow rate, pressure, temperature, and vibration. By keeping a close eye on the pump’s performance, you can minimize the risk of breakdowns and reduce the need for emergency maintenance.
